Huawei-powered Avatr 11 gets a refresh with new EREV and BEV variants

Chinese automaker Avatr Technology, backed by Changan Automobile, CATL, and Huawei, has refreshed its Avatr 11 model with the addition of extended-range (EREV) variants. This is Avatr's second model, following the Avatr 07, to offer both BEV and EREV options.

Originally launched in August 2022 as a BEV-only model, the Avatr 11 was the first premium vehicle in China to feature Huawei Inside, Huawei's comprehensive smart car solution, as a standard feature. The introduction of EREV variants is a direct response to the growing demand for electric vehicles that alleviate range anxiety.

Refreshed Avatr 11 gets new EREV and BEV variants

The Avatr 11 EREV is equipped with CATL's battery pack with a capacity of 39.05 kWh. It provides a pure electric range of 140 miles. With a full tank of fuel and a fully charged battery, the Avatr 11 EREV promises an impressive CLTC range of up to 662 miles.

Available in two variants, the Avatr 11 EREV starts at RMB 279,900 ($38,400) and RMB 299,900 ($41,150). Both variants feature a single-motor, rear-wheel-drive configuration, capable of accelerating from 0 to 62 mph in 6.9 seconds and reaching a top speed of 124 mph.

The battery-powered Avatr 11 continues to be offered in three variants, priced at RMB 339,900 ($46,650), RMB 369,900 ($50,750), and RMB 429,900 ($59,000). Thanks to the CATL-supplied Li-ion ternary battery pack with a capacity of 116.79 kWh, the Avatr 11 BEV delivers a CLTC range of up to 506 miles for the single-motor rear-wheel-drive variant and 472 miles for the dual-motor four-wheel-drive variants. The four-wheel-drive versions accelerate from 0 to 62 mph in a respectable 3.9 seconds.
